  • Calculate pOH from pH: A Simple Chemistry Guide
    Here's how to calculate pOH from a given pH:

    Understanding the Relationship

    * pH + pOH = 14 This is a fundamental relationship in chemistry. It's based on the auto-ionization of water (H₂O).

    Calculation

    1. Start with the pH: pH = 6.2

    2. Use the equation: pOH = 14 - pH

    3. Substitute and solve: pOH = 14 - 6.2 = 7.8

    Answer: The pOH of a solution with a pH of 6.2 is 7.8.
